Average Worker Switches Careers by Age 31

Gone are the days of staying in the same career your entire life it appears.

A new survey shows that the average worker is likely to change their career direction by the age of 31.

For many, this age marks a decade in the workplace, suggesting that today’s employee gets the “10-year career itch” before pivoting to a new vocation.

The poll, of 5,000 employed adults, found 26 percent are considering a career change in the not-too-distant future, while 44 percent have already made the leap to something completely new.
